crbttestclient.java

来自「中国联通炫铃业务接口开发」· Java 代码 · 共 47 行

JAVA
47
字号
package com.wireless.crbt.gwif.netty2;

import org.apache.log4j.Logger;

import com.wireless.crbt.gwif.global.LoggerConstant;
import com.wireless.gwif.socketconn.ConnManageInterface;

public class CrbtTestClient implements Runnable,ConnManageInterface{
    private Logger log = LoggerConstant.log;
    private boolean stop_flg = false;
    private boolean is_stop = false;

    public CrbtTestClient() {
    }

    public void start(){
        stop_flg = false;
        new Thread(this).start();
    }

    public void stop(){
        stop_flg = true;
    }

    public boolean isFinishStop(){
        return is_stop;
    }

    public void run() {
        try {
            log.info("");
            log.info("=========测试模式启动=========");
            while (!stop_flg) {
                try {
                	Thread.sleep(5000);
                } catch (Exception w) {}
            }
        } catch (Exception w) {
            w.printStackTrace();
        } finally {
            is_stop = true;
            log.info("=======连接结束========");
        }
    }

}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?